Daniele Piaggesi a écrit :

Hi

I have to install a new mailserver for my company on a red hat enterprise linux 5 and I choosed Courier as my suite. I've builded rpm package with rpmbuild, following Courier website instructions and I've installed this package:

courier-authlib-0.59.3-10.rh5Server courier-authlib-ldap-0.59.3-10.rh5Server courier-pop3d-0.56.0-1.5Server courier-webadmin-0.56.0-1.5Server courier-authlib-devel-0.59.3-10.rh5Server courier-maildrop-0.56.0-1.5Server courier-imapd-0.56.0-1.5Server courier-maildrop-wrapper-0.56.0-1.5Server courier-0.56.0-1.5Server courier-ldap-0.56.0-1.5Server

I've a problem with imap-over-ssl and pop3-over-ssl. I used mkimapdcert and mkpop3dcert to create my self-signed certs and then I set up imapd-ssl and pop3d-ssl with

*TLS_PROTOCOL=SSL23

You have to use courier snapshot (01-Jul-2007) to solve this issue.
